Your project file itself does not use a lot of space, but your media work "hidden" files take up much space

Moving your media files means that you will need to add a link to it when you open the project... which is a pretty painless process "generally"

The other thing you need to do, when you create a project, is manually set all your files cache on the disk with more space... read drive C http://forums.adobe.com/thread/1007934?tstart=0 and adjust your settings accordingly (reply 4) and delete the cache on your boot disk, so recreate your outdoor space
